Transaction 5a21d956c3c719957231060a45a4305ddd654cfc04661075764bb434075f2ad0
1 Input
1 Output
-
5a21d956c3c719957231060a45a4305ddd654cfc04661075764bb434075f2ad0:0
- value
- 24268
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 a34a31fe29e145f0d86959e855957e03dd39935a OP_EQUALVERIFY OP_CHECKSIG
- address
- 1FtQ2Sw3e891RWDsFquy2ssyayW75HfdbW